Tagged: Backup Failure, Total Upkeep
- AuthorPosts
- July 20, 2023 at 10:18 am #97887David GuestHello, I want to use Total upkeep plugin which I installed today, but it has fatal errors and its not possible to backup. : Uncaught TypeError: fread(): Argument #1 ($stream) must be of type resource, bool given in /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php:139 Stack trace: #0 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php(139): fread(false, 4096) #1 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-core.php(935): Boldgrid_Backup_Admin_Cli::call_command('crontab -l > /t...', false, 0) #2 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ron.php(674): Boldgrid_Backup_Admin_Core->execute_command('crontab -l > /t...', false) #3 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ron.php(597): Boldgrid_Backup_Admin_Cron->get_all() #4 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ron.php(396): Boldgrid_Backup_Admin_Cron->entry_exists('# Total Upkeep ...') #5 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-test.php(434): Boldgrid_Backup_Admin_Cron->update_cron('# Total Upkeep ...') #6 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-scheduler.php(102): Boldgrid_Backup_Admin_Test->is_crontab_available() #7 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-scheduler.php(69): Boldgrid_Backup_Admin_Scheduler->get_available() #8 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-cron.php(45): Boldgrid_Backup_Admin_Scheduler->get() #9 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-cron.php(59): Boldgrid\Backup\Admin\Cron->get_engine() #10 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/card/feature/class-scheduled-backups.php(37): Boldgrid\Backup\Admin\Cron->get_entry('backup') #11 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/vendor/boldgrid/library/src/Library/Ui/Card.php(126): Boldgrid\Backup\Admin\Card\Feature\Scheduled_Backups->init() #12 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/vendor/boldgrid/library/src/Library/Ui/Dashboard.php(61): Boldgrid\Library\Library\Ui\Card->printCard() #13 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/partials/boldgrid-backup-admin-dashboard.php(29): Boldgrid\Library\Library\Ui\Dashboard->printCards() #14 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-dashboard.php(114): include('/data/c/f/cf837...') #15 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/class-wp-hook.php(308): Boldgrid_Backup_Admin_Dashboard->page('') #16 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/class-wp-hook.php(332): WP_Hook->apply_filters('', Array) #17 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/plugin.php(517): WP_Hook->do_action(Array) #18 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-admin/admin.php(259): do_action('toplevel_page_b...') #19 {main} thrown inJuly 20, 2023 at 11:39 am #97913Brandon C ParticipantHi David, Thank you for reaching out with your Total Upkeep questions although I’m sorry to hear you’re having trouble creating backups. I have some questions for you so that we can begin troubleshooting your issue. 1.) What is your PHP version number? 2.) What is your WordPress core version? 3.) How exactly are you attempting to create your backup? (ex: Total Upkeep dashboard, WordPress CLI etc) 4.) Can you navigate to Preflight Check from your WordPress admin dashboard Total Upkeep > Dashboard > Preflight Check and make sure your site passes the Functionality test. You can refer to this guide to check out steps to take when the site check fails. We also have a a detailed list of steps you can take to troubleshoot Total Upkeep backup failure errors. I hope this helps David and we look forward to assisting you further with this! July 20, 2023 at 3:58 pm #97917David GuestThanks for reply. It’s not possible to do preflight check as well, there is this error available: Warning: popen(crontab -l > /tmp/boldgrid_backup/crontab 2>/dev/null,r): Permission denied in /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php on line 137 Fatal error: Uncaught TypeError: fread(): Argument #1 ($stream) must be of type resource, bool given in /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php:139 Stack trace: #0 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php(139): fread(false, 4096) #1 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-core.php(935): Boldgrid_Backup_Admin_Cli::call_command('crontab -l > /t...', false, 0) #2 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ron.php(674): Boldgrid_Backup_Admin_Core->execute_command('crontab -l > /t...', false) #3 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ron.php(616): Boldgrid_Backup_Admin_Cron->get_all() #4 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cron-test.php(165): Boldgrid_Backup_Admin_Cron->entry_search('/data/c/f/cf837...') #5 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-core.php(2889): Boldgrid_Backup_Admin_Cron_Test->is_running() #6 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/class-wp-hook.php(308): Boldgrid_Backup_Admin_Core->page_backup_test('') #7 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/class-wp-hook.php(332): WP_Hook->apply_filters('', Array) #8 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-includes/plugin.php(517): WP_Hook->do_action(Array) #9 /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-admin/admin.php(259): do_action('total-upkeep_pa...') #10 {main} thrown in /data/c/f/cf8377f2-6293-4e48-a3cd-7b172316e806/ekoservislm.sk/web/wp-content/plugins/boldgrid-backup/admin/class-boldgrid-backup-admin-cli.php on line 139Answers to questions: 1) php version 8.0 
 2) WP version 6.2.2.
 3) tried with dasboard and also with backup tab in the pluginJuly 20, 2023 at 4:09 pm #97936Brandon C ParticipantThanks for that David, I think this could be an actual bug. The Boolean falseis indicative of an error occurring usingpopen. We check later down in the code to find if it was false, but the error is happening becausefread, the value of popen has already tried to open. That means we probably need to check for that false before we try tofread.I feel the root cause of this still could be a server related issue because popenlooks like it’s available but is erroring out, but we could prevent that fatal if we provided a checked before reading it.I’ve created the bug ticket for this issue and I’m hoping to have it resolved quickly and go out in the next patch. I’ll be sure to keep you updated here. Thank you, 
 Brandon C.-  This reply was modified 2 years, 3 months ago by Brandon C. 
 July 21, 2023 at 5:17 am #97979David GuestHello, thanks for info. I hope it will be fixed soon. it’s also impossible to uninstall the plugin July 21, 2023 at 5:19 am #97985Brandon C ParticipantHey David, We will definitely get right back to you with an update. You should be able to remove the plugin using FTP or your web hosting accounts file manager. You’d just need to locate the plugins folder for your website and delete the Total Upkeep folder from there. Thanks David, we hope to have this resolved for you soon! July 25, 2023 at 10:44 am #98632David Guesthello, is there any update regarding this problem? thanks July 25, 2023 at 10:46 am #98653Brandon C ParticipantHi David, Thanks for reaching back out. We have come up with a resolution for this issue and it’s currently going through code review so that we can have it implemented immediately. I’ll be sure to let you know the moment that it becomes available or in the case that we have any other updates. Thanks so much for your patience and for working with us on this! 
-  This reply was modified 2 years, 3 months ago by 
- AuthorPosts
- The topic ‘Experiencing a backup error with Total Upkeep’ is closed to new replies.
 
 

